How to fill out Confidentiality Agreement

01
Begin with the title of the document: 'Confidentiality Agreement'.
02
Include the date of the agreement at the top.
03
Identify the parties involved (disclosing and receiving parties) and provide their contact information.
04
Define 'Confidential Information' to clarify what information is protected under the agreement.
05
Outline the obligations of the receiving party regarding confidentiality and non-disclosure.
06
Specify the duration of the confidentiality obligation.
07
Include any exclusions from confidentiality (e.g., publicly available information).
08
State the acceptable uses of the confidential information.
09
Provide clauses for termination of the agreement and the return or destruction of information.
10
Include signatures from all parties involved, along with the date of signing.

Who needs Confidentiality Agreement?

01
Businesses entering negotiations to share sensitive information.
02
Employees handling proprietary company data.
03
Freelancers or contractors working with confidential materials.
04
Parties involved in mergers or acquisitions.
05
Researchers collaborating on projects with sensitive findings.

An NDA typically involves one party disclosing confidential information to another, with the recipient obligated to maintain confidentiality. In contrast, an MNDA involves a mutual exchange of sensitive information between two or more parties, with all parties agreeing to safeguard the shared information.

A Confidentiality Agreement, also known as a Non-Disclosure Agreement (NDA), is a legal contract that establishes a relationship of trust between parties, ensuring that sensitive information shared remains private and is not disclosed to unauthorized individuals.
Typically, any individual or organization that plans to share proprietary or sensitive information with another party is required to file a Confidentiality Agreement to protect that information during and after the business relationship.
To fill out a Confidentiality Agreement, provide the names of the parties involved, clearly define the confidential information, specify the obligations and rights of each party regarding that information, and include a duration of confidentiality and any exclusions to the agreement.
The purpose of a Confidentiality Agreement is to protect sensitive information from being disclosed to third parties, thus preserving the intellectual property, trade secrets, and proprietary information of the parties involved.
The information reported on a Confidentiality Agreement typically includes the names of the disclosing and receiving parties, definition of what constitutes confidential information, terms and conditions for handling that information, duration of the agreement, and any legal obligations pertaining to the confidentiality.
